  • 摘要:The aim of this study is to develop a scale to determine attitudes towards social networks. During the development phase of the scale, 55 items were created and presented to experts. Experts demand that 2 items be removed from the scale. The 53 item draft scale was applied to 270 persons as a preliminary experiment group in the age range of 18-53 years. In order to determne the valdty of the structure of the scale, exploratory factor analyss was carred out by analyss of basc components. As a result of these analyzes, a scale consstng of 40 tems whch explans 56.650% of total varance wth 6 factors (request, preference, communcaton, aff ecton, socalzaton, frendshp) was obtaned. The relablty coeff cent of all the scales was Cronbach α = .95. As a result of the prelmnary test, t was revealed that the tems were understandable and that a few expressons were requred. By makng the necessary changes ,the data collecton devce has the fnal structure .The scale’s average was calculated as 3.13, medan 3.20 and standard devaton .72. Having the KMO value above .90 , datas are considered to be so convenient for factor analysis. Moreover, after Barlett’s test X2 value 7164.145 (p <.001) indicates that the scale is convenient for factor analysis. The results obtained prove scale to be valid and reliable.
